  4. Hace 5 días · But Blair Witch had the advantage, first of all, of an ingenious marketing campaign that sold it as a genuine documentary – missing persons posters and a website all helped create the myth that the three people at the heart of the story had genuinely gone missing.

  6. Hace 1 día · This year marks the 25th anniversary of The Blair Witch Project, a film that popularised the found-footage horror sub-genre and captivated a generation of horror fans. Made on a shoestring budget of less than US$60,000 by writer/director team Daniel Myrick and Eduardo Sanchez, the film went on to gross US$248 million internationally, becoming one of the most successful films of all time by ...
